Event Description
Join us for a two-day drumming workshop led by Brent Edgar (Mucmukw7kus) of the Nuxalk Nation. Brent is a master drum maker, singer, and respected knowledge holder. With over 30 years of experience in drumming and singing, Brent shares his teachings with deep respect for the traditions and protocols passed down to him.
During this workshop, participants will:
- Learn about drum protocols and teachings
- Explore the cultural significance of drumming and singing
- Be guided through a traditional drum song
- Build connection through shared learning and practice
